Towing cost in Santa Barbara, CA
A typical Towing figure in Santa Barbara is about $143 per tow, about 15% above the national figure of $125.

Questions people ask
Towing in Santa Barbara: what does it cost?
In Santa Barbara, CA, Towing typically costs about $143 per tow, with most prices between $58 and $344.
Why is Santa Barbara higher than the national price?
This estimate moves the national figure halfway with what the workers behind Towing earn in Santa Barbara, from federal wage data, and halfway with the local cost of living. Together they put Santa Barbara about 15% above the national figure.
Is this a quote?
No. It is an estimate built from national price data and local cost of living. A local pro will price your actual job.
